KPMP sends personalized participant update letters twice a yearβ€”a rare move in research.

Instead of waiting 5–10 years for results, participants get timely updates on new publications with plain-language summaries that make the science human, relevant, and connected. Learn more: shkd.us/AngadyYD

🚨 Big news: The Q3 2025 Kidney Tissue Atlas is live!

πŸ”¬ Updates include:
- New Single-cell & Single-nucleus RNA-seq data
- Expanded samples + novel cell types
- Whole Genome Sequence data (with DUA)

Huge thanks to our participant heroes + research teams driving this forward.
